Effect of the flow regime on flutter in collapsible tubes


Abstract eng:
We study the stability of elastic tubes conveying fluids. An apparatus for investigations of self-exciting oscillations of the elastic Penrose tubes was created. The effect of the flow regime (laminar vs turbulent) on the limit cycle oscillations and the stability boundary is experimentally analyzed. The influence of the fluid viscosity on the limit cycle oscillations is studied. Maps of regimes are obtained.
